2 – Croatia coach Ante Čačić won both of his competitive (qualifying) games since replacing Niko Kovač in September 2015.
5 – Croatia have qualified for five of the six European Championships since their independence.
6 – Croatia are unbeaten in all six previous meetings with Turkey (W2, D4).
7 – Croatia have not conceded more than 1 goal in a single European Championship game since losing 4-2 at EUro 2004 (7 games).
27 – Only Switzerland’s three goalkeepers (25) have fewer caps than Croatia’s trio (27) heading into Euro 2016.
67% – Darijo Srna has played in four of the six matches between these two nations.
75% – Turkey manager Fatih Terim has lead his country to three of the four European Championships they have qualified for in their history.
121 – Semih Şentürk’s 121st minute equaliser versus Croatia in Euro 2008 was the latest goal ever scored at a European Championship.
1996 – Croatia and Turkey made their debut at Euro 96, both meeting in the group stage (Croatia won 1-0). The Turkish coach that day was Fatih Terim who is also their current coach.
2018 – These two nations have been drawn together in qualifying for the 2018 FIFA World Cup.
